as you can see, the presentation of the food speaks volumes too. i had a stunning fillet steak wrapped in parma ham, topped with dolcelatte cheese and served on a bed of rocket. known as the filleto dolce parma, this comes in at £18.90 and comes with fresh seasonal veg. don't be put off by prices though - there were lots of other dishes around the £10 mark. i was just making the most of my birthday! :)
now, anything with steak, parma ham and rocket and i'm sold. i'm not really a fan of strong cheese but i trusted that the chef knew better than me and didn't ask for it to be altered. i'm SO glad i just went with it - it was divine! i asked for it rare and as you can see from my (sorry a tad messy) picture, the meat was perfectly cooked.
for dessert, i had a special which was a chocolate terrine. it came quite cold and melted in the mouth. i was slightly disappointed as i don't really like cold chocolate (people that put chocolate in the fridge truly baffle me) and expected more of a mousse in a pot. but hey, it's chocolate right?
